Positrons implanted into the solid are thermalized and can diffuse to the surface. The probability of trapping positrons by the solid surface and by the surface of defects is calculated. Obvious analytic expressions for W( t ), F, and I v ( t ) in terms of special functions are obtained, as well as an obvious criterion for the case of many defects. The obtained results show that the dynamics of a thermalized positron interaction with a surface affects the positron lifetime spectra.
